Application: Carvacrol has been used in low concentrations as a food flavoring ingredient and preservative, as well as a fragrance ingredient in cosmetic formulations. Boiling Point: 238°C. Melting Point: 3°C. Density: 0.97 g/cm3. Product Description: Carvacrol is a monoterpenic phenol produced by aromatic plants, thyme and oregano. It exhibits potent antibacterial activity against Salmonella typhimurium. Bactericidal activity of carvacrol towards the food borne pathogen Bacillus cereus has been investigated. Carvacrol has been evaluated as alternatives to antibiotic feed additives in female broiler chickens. CD Formulation

Carvacrol Carvacrol is an orally active and blood-brain barrier-permeable monoterpenic phenol that can be extract from an abundant number of aromatic plants, including thyme and oregano, possessing antioxidant, antibacterial, antifungal, anticancer, anti-inflammatory, hepatoprotective, spasmolytic, and vasorelaxant properties. Carvacrol also causes cell cycle arrest in G0/G1, downregulates Notch-1, and Jagged-1, and induces apoptosis. Carvacrol is used in low concentrations as a food flavoring ingredient and preservative, as well as a fragrance ingredient in cosmetic formulations[1][2]. Uses: Scientific research. Carvedilol Carvedilol (BM 14190) is a non-selective β/α-1 blocker[1]. Carvedilol inhibits lipid peroxidation in a dose-dependent manner with an IC50 of 5 μM. Carvedilol is a multiple action antihypertensive agent with potential use in angina and congestive heart failure[2]. Carvedilol is an autophagy inducer that inhibits the NLRP3 inflammasome[3].
